MATLAB备份文件夹路径设置指南
matlab备份文件夹路径

首页 2025-04-26 21:12:03



确保数据安全:高效管理MATLAB备份文件夹路径的策略与实践 在当今的科学计算、工程分析及数据处理的广阔领域中,MATLAB作为一款功能强大的软件工具,凭借其丰富的算法库、直观的用户界面以及高效的编程环境,成为了无数科研工作者和工程师的首选

    然而,随着项目复杂度的提升和数据量的激增,如何确保MATLAB工作环境及其数据的安全,特别是如何合理设置和管理MATLAB备份文件夹路径,成为了不容忽视的关键问题

    本文旨在深入探讨MATLAB备份文件夹路径的重要性、设置方法、自动化策略以及最佳实践,以期为广大用户提供一套全面而有效的数据管理方案

     一、MATLAB备份文件夹路径的重要性 在MATLAB的工作流程中,无论是脚本、函数、模型文件,还是处理过程中生成的大量临时数据和结果文件,都是宝贵的智力成果

    一旦因系统崩溃、硬盘故障或人为误操作导致数据丢失,不仅可能意味着长时间努力的付诸东流,还可能对项目进度造成不可估量的影响

    因此,定期备份这些关键文件至一个安全可靠的存储位置,是保护数据完整性、提升工作效率的基石

     备份文件夹路径的选择,直接关系到备份操作的便捷性、安全性和效率

    一个合理的备份路径应具备以下几个特点: 1.独立性:备份文件应存放在与系统盘或工作目录分离的存储介质上,以防止局部故障导致数据全部丢失

     2.易访问性:备份位置应便于用户快速定位,便于日后恢复数据

     3.安全性:考虑到数据敏感性,备份路径应具备一定的访问控制机制,防止未经授权的访问

     4.冗余性:对于重要数据,应考虑采用多地点备份或云存储服务,以提高数据恢复的成功率

     二、设置MATLAB备份文件夹路径的方法 MATLAB本身并不直接提供内置的自动化备份功能,但用户可以通过编写脚本、利用MATLAB的内置函数以及结合操作系统工具,实现备份任务的自动化

    以下是一些实用的设置方法: 1.手动指定备份路径: - 在MATLAB中,可以使用`uigetdir`函数让用户手动选择备份目录

    例如,创建一个备份脚本,首先提示用户选择备份路径,然后利用`copyfile`函数将指定文件夹下的文件复制到该路径

     2.自动化脚本: - 利用MATLAB的`schedule`功能或操作系统的任务计划程序(如Windows的任务计划器或Linux的cron作业),定期运行备份脚本

    脚本中可包含逻辑判断,仅复制自上次备份以来有变动的文件,以减少不必要的存储占用和备份时间

     3.集成版本控制系统: - 对于代码文件,可以考虑使用Git等版本控制系统进行备份和版本管理

    MATLAB支持Git集成,用户可以在MATLAB编辑器中直接进行代码的提交、拉取等操作,实现代码的历史版本记录和协作开发

     4.使用第三方工具: - 市场上有许多专门的数据备份和同步软件,如Dropbox、Google Drive的备份客户端等,它们通常提供命令行接口,允许用户通过MATLAB脚本调用,实现数据的自动上传备份

     三、自动化备份策略 实现MATLAB备份文件夹路径的自动化管理,关键在于制定一套高效且灵活的备份策略

    以下策略可供参考: 1.增量备份与全量备份结合: - 日常备份采用增量备份,仅备份自上次备份以来发生变化的数据,以减少备份时间和存储空间需求

    定期(如每月或每季度)进行一次全量备份,确保所有数据的完整存档

     2.设置备份窗口: - 根据工作习惯和系统负载情况,选择非高峰时段进行备份操作,避免影响正常工作

     3.数据校验与日志记录: - 每次备份完成后,进行文件完整性校验(如使用MD5或SHA-256哈希值),确保备份数据的准确性

    同时,记录备份操作的详细信息至日志文件,便于追踪和故障排查

     4.灾难恢复演练: - 定期进行数据恢复演练,验证备份数据的可用性和恢复流程的可行性,确保在真实灾难发生时能够迅速响应

     四、最佳实践 1.多样化存储策略: - 除了本地备份,考虑使用云存储服务或远程服务器作为备份目的地,实现数据的异地容灾

     2.数据加密: - 对于敏感数据,在备份前进行加密处理,确保即使备份数据被非法获取,也无法直接读取

     3.用户教育与培训: - 提高团队成员对数据备份重要性的认识,定期进行备份策略和操作方法的培训,形成良好的数据管理文化

     4.持续监控与优化: - 监控备份任务的执行情况和存储空间使用情况,根据实际情况调整备份策略,如增加备份频率、优化备份路径等

     结语 在数据驱动的时代背景下,MATLAB备份文件夹路径的有效管理不仅是个人工作效率的保障,更是团队协作和项目成功的关键

    通过合理设置备份路径、采用自动化备份策略以及遵循最佳实践,我们可以最大限度地降低数据丢失的风险,确保科研和工程项目的顺利进行

    随着技术的不断进步,未来还将有更多创新的解决方案涌现,帮助我们更加高效、安全地管理MATLAB工作环境中的每一份宝贵数据

    让我们携手共进,在数据管理的道路上不断探索与实践,共创更加辉煌的科研成就

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密